New Delhi (March 11, 2020)

Home Minister Amit Shah on Wednesday said Delhi Police had “successfully contained” the recent riots in Delhi to a 4 per cent area and 13 per cent population.

Expressing his deepest sympathy and condolences to all those killed, injured and affected in the riots, Shah, who was addressing Lok Sabha in reply to a discussion on the issue,  said the  Narendra Modi government would not spare those involved in the riots..........
